Oakland - Lucy Jane Bledsoe discusses and signs "The Big Bang Symphony"Thu, 05/06/2010 - 7:00pm
Lucy Jane Bledsoe is a novelist and science writer. When she's not writing, she's sea kayaking in Alaska, backpacking in the Rockies, or backcountry skiing in the Sierras. When she's not kayaking, hiking, or skiing, she's reading. Bledsoe won the 2009 Sherwood Anderson Foundation Fiction Award. Her story "Girl with Boat" won the 2009 Arts & Letters Prize for Fiction, and her story "Enough" won the 2009 International Arts Movement Prize for Fiction.
